/* Essential Menu Styles */

#navbar_menu, #navbar_menu * {
	/*margin : 0;
	padding : 0;
	list-style : none;*/
	z-index: 9999;
	position: relative;
}
/*
#navbar_menu ul {
	position : absolute;
	top : -999em;
	width : 150px;
	margin-left: 18px;
	border-bottom: 2px #dfdfdf solid;
	z-index: 9999;
}

#navbar_menu ul li {
	width : 100%;
}

#navbar_menu li:hover {
	visibility : inherit;
}

#navbar_menu li {
	float : left;
	position : relative;
	background: #ffffff;
}

#navbar_menu a {
	display : block;
	position : relative;
}

#navbar_menu ul li a {
	margin: 0 !important;
	padding: 6px;
	border-bottom: 1px #dfdfdf solid;
}

#navbar_menu ul li a:hover {
	background: #f3f3f3;
}

#navbar_menu li:hover ul, #navbar_menu li.sfHover ul {
	left : 0;
	top : 26px;
	z-index : 99;
}

ul#navbar_menu li:hover li ul, ul#navbar_menu li.sfHover li ul {
	top : -999em;
}

ul#navbar_menu li li:hover ul, ul#navbar_menu li li.sfHover ul {
	left : 150px;
	top : 0;
}

ul#navbar_menu li li:hover li ul, ul#navbar_menu li li.sfHover li ul {
	top : -999em;
}

ul#navbar_menu li li li:hover ul, ul#navbar_menu li li li.sfHover ul {
	left : 150px;
	top : 0;
}
*/
#navbar_menu ul {
	position:absolute;
}
ul#navbar_menu li {
	float:left;
	position:relative;
	width:120px;
}
ul#navbar_menu li a {
	display:block;
	width:100px;
	float:left;
}

ul#navbar_menu li ul li {
	float:left;
	position:relative;
	top:62px; 
	text-transform:capitalize; 
}

ul#navbar_menu li ul li a {
	display:block;
	z-index:2;
	background-color:#236f6b;
	width:170px; 
}
ul#navbar_menu li ul li a:hover {
	display:block;
	width:170px;
	float:left; 
}